次の方法で共有


Visual Studio の外部ツール

更新 : 2007 年 11 月

Visual Studio には、アプリケーションの開発やデバッグに使用できる外部ツールがあります。ATL/MFC トレース ツールや Windows CE リモート ファイル ビューアなど、これらのツールの一部は、それぞれ Visual Studio の [ツール] メニューや Visual Studio[リモート ツール] メニューで既に使用できます。その他のツールは、<Visual Studio installation path>\Microsoft Visual Studio 9.0\Common7\Tools\ または <Visual Studio installation path>\Microsoft Visual Studio 9.0\VC\ に格納されています。

これらのユーティリティは、Visual Studio 統合開発環境 (IDE: Integrated Development Environment) の外部で実行できますが、[外部ツール] ダイアログ ボックスを使って [ツール] メニューに追加することもできます。詳細については、「方法 : Visual Studio からツールを起動する」を参照してください。

ショートカット経由で使用できるツール

次のツールは、Windows の [プログラム] メニューまたは [すべてのプログラム] メニューから使用できます。[Microsoft Visual Studio 2008] をクリックし、[Visual Studio Tools] をクリックします。

ツール

詳細情報

Dotfuscator Community Edition

アプリケーションをリバース エンジニアリングから保護できます。詳細については、このツールの [ヘルプ] をクリックしてください。

MFC-ATL Trace Tool

ATLTraceTool サンプル : ATLTRACE2 の出力の表示

Visual Studio 2008 x64 クロス ツール コマンド プロンプト

Visual Studio 2008 コマンド プロンプト

Visual Studio 2008Itanium クロス ツール コマンド プロンプト

方法 : 64 ビットの Visual C++ ツールセットをコマンド ラインから有効にする

Visual Studio 2008 リモート デバッガ

Visual Studio 2008 リモート デバッガ構成ウィザード

方法 : リモート デバッグをセットアップする

SPY++

システムのプロセス、スレッド、ウィンドウ、およびウィンドウ メッセージがグラフィカルに表示されます。詳細については、このツールの [ヘルプ] をクリックしてください。

次のツールは、Windows の [プログラム] メニューまたは [すべてのプログラム] メニューから使用できます。[Microsoft Visual Studio 2008] をクリックし、[Visual Studio Remote Tools] をクリックします。

ツール

説明

Windows CE リモート ファイル ビューア

対象デバイスのファイル システムを階層構造で表示します。詳細については、このツールの [ヘルプ] をクリックしてください。

Windows CE リモート ヒープ ウォーカ

対象デバイスで実行されている各プロセスについて、ヒープ ID とフラグに関する情報を表示します。プロセスが使用するシステム メモリに関する情報も表示します。詳細については、このツールの [ヘルプ] をクリックしてください。

Windows CE Remote Process Walker

対象デバイスで実行されている各プロセスに関連付けられた情報を表示します。詳細については、このツールの [ヘルプ] をクリックしてください。

Windows CE リモート レジストリ エディタ

対象デバイスのレジストリを表示し、レジストリ キーとレジストリ エントリを追加、削除、および変更できます。詳細については、このツールの [ヘルプ] をクリックしてください。

Windows CE リモート スパイ

対象デバイスで実行されているアプリケーションに関連付けられた、Windows の受信メッセージを表示します。詳細については、このツールの [ヘルプ] をクリックしてください。

Windows CE リモート ズームイン

対象デバイスの画面イメージを表示します。詳細については、このツールの [ヘルプ] をクリックしてください。

Visual Studio の [ツール] メニューで使用できるツール

次の表は、Visual Studio の [ツール] メニューから既定で使用できるツールの一覧です。これらの各ツールは、Dotfuscator Community Edition を除き、Visual Studio の \Tools\ フォルダにあります。

ファイル名

名前

場所

説明

GuidGen

GUID の作成

\Microsoft Visual Studio 9.0\Common7\Tools\

指定された基準に基づいて GUID を生成します。詳細については、「GUIDGEN サンプル : グローバル一意識別子 (GUID) の生成」を参照してください。

Dotfuscator

Dotfuscator Community Edition

\Microsoft Visual Studio 9.0\Application\PreEmptive Solutions\

アプリケーションをリバース エンジニアリングから保護できます。詳細については、このツールの [ヘルプ] をクリックしてください。

ErrLook

Error Lookup

\Microsoft Visual Studio 9.0\Common7\Tools\

入力された値に基づいて、システムやモジュールのエラー メッセージを表示します。詳細については、「ERRLOOK リファレンス」を参照してください。

AtlTraceTool8

ATL/MFC Trace Tool

\Microsoft Visual Studio 9.0\Common7\Tools\

ATL ソースと MFC ソースのデバッグ トレース メッセージを表示します。表示されるメッセージの種類と数は制御できます。詳細については、「ATLTraceTool サンプル : ATLTRACE2 の出力の表示」を参照してください。

Spyxx

SPY++ 9.0

\Microsoft Visual Studio 9.0\Common7\Tools\

システムのプロセス、スレッド、ウィンドウ、およびウィンドウ メッセージがグラフィカルに表示されます。詳細については、このツールの [ヘルプ] をクリックしてください。

その他のツール

その他のツールおよびユーティリティは、次の場所にあります。

  • <Visual Studio installation path>\Microsoft Visual Studio 9.0\Common7\Tools\

  • <Visual Studio installation path>\Microsoft Visual Studio 9.0\Common7\Tools\bin\

  • <Visual Studio installation path>\Microsoft Visual Studio 9.0\VC\bin\

  • <Visual Studio installation path>\Microsoft Visual Studio 9.0\VC\PlatformSDK\bin\

76712d27.alert_note(ja-jp,VS.90).gifメモ :

これらのツールおよびユーティリティのヘルプを見つけるには、Visual Studio ヘルプの [検索] ページまたは [目次] を使用してツールのファイル名を探します。

参照

処理手順

方法 : Visual Studio からツールを起動する

参照

C と C++ のビルド ツール